Fluent Money has appointed Tim Wheeldon as chief executive of the broker. 

The firm says Wheeldon has “a wealth of experience” at the business having been one of the founding members of the company in 2008 alongside Kevin Hindley, Paul Ford, and Simon Moore. 

It adds that his “extensive background and strategic vision make him well-suited to lead the company”. 

Wheeldon was previously chief operating officer at Fluent Money, which was bought by rival broker Mortgage Advice Bureau for £72.2m in 2022. 

Wheeldon says: “Fluent’s journey has been remarkable and one that I am excited to continue.” 

MAB chief executive Peter Brodnicki adds: “Tim’s deep-rooted understanding of Fluent’s journey, coupled with his strategic foresight, puts him in the ideal position to guide us into Fluent’s next phase of growth, and we look forward to a productive and innovative future under his leadership.” 

Last week, Mortgage Advice Bureau said the total number of advisers in its group fell by 4% to 2,158 last year from 12 months ago, following a “difficult market”.    

It added that 117 advisers from Fluent Mortgage and Protection were included in the job losses the network had made over the last year.
